On Saturday 12 June 2010 06:55:10 pm Patrick Okui wrote: > The fact that addresses are incompatible on the wire is > in fact my biggest gripe with v6.
Unfortunately, there's no sane way to fit 128 bits of v6 addressing into 32 bits of v4 :-(. > One can't just deploy > a single stack v6 only network without then toying with > some form of NAT. Looks like there's no other way we shall deal with the inter-working requirements between v4 and v6 for the foreseeable future. Any kind of translation between both protocols will involve some form of NAT. Cheers, Mark.
